Que sera, sera. It was not to be. Blair Connell’s star-studded Battersea team – boasting two IMs and the legendary Ginger GM Simon Williams – lost out in the Alexander Cup final last week to a spirited Kingston.

The match went right down to the wire as Silverio Abasolo beat IM Chris Baker to seal a 5.5-4.5 win.

Battersea beat Surbiton, Coulsdon and Epsom on their run to the final, but could not overcome the holders.

It brought an end to Blairs attempt to bag a first title for Battersea in Surreys premier cup competition since 1953.

So Batterseas seven years of hurt continuebut there is always next year.
